gro: Flush GRO packets in napi_disable_pending path

When NAPI is disabled while we're in net_rx_action, we end up
calling __napi_complete without flushing GRO packets.  This is
a bug as it would cause the GRO packets to linger, of course it
also literally BUGs to catch error like this :)

This patch changes it to napi_complete, with the obligatory IRQ
reenabling.  This should be safe because we've only just disabled
IRQs and it does not materially affect the test conditions in
between.
